Frequently Asked Questions About silicone skull ice cube mold
How do I pick the right silicone skull ice cube mold for my drinks and events?
Start by matching size, cavity count, and the level of detail to your needs, then check safety and features. Look for skull-shaped molds made of food-grade silicone that is BPA-free, so cubes are easy to release and safe for consumption. A lid or cover helps prevent odors and spills in the freezer or fridge, and keeps shapes pristine for parties. Prefer molds labeled dishwasher-safe if you want quick cleanup, and choose a brand with good reviews or a reliable generic silicone line for value.

What maintenance and compatibility tips should I follow to keep my silicone skull ice cube mold in good shape?
Rinse and wash after each use with mild soap, and air-dry completely to prevent mold or odor. Most silicone molds in this category are BPA-free and food-safe, and several models include lids to protect the cubes and simplify stacking in the freezer. Check freezer compatibility and, if labeled, dishwasher safety for quick cleaning; avoid using knives or sharp tools to release cubes to prevent tearing. Store molds flat or upright to protect the skull shapes and extend their life.

What is the best way to use a silicone skull ice cube mold at home, bars, or events to get consistent results?
Prep the mold by washing and drying, then fill with water, juice, or a cocktail-friendly mix up to the recommended level to avoid overflow. Freeze until solid, then gently flex the silicone and push from the bottom to release the skull cubes. Use lids on compatible sets to keep cubes fresh in the freezer and reduce odors, and stack or store the molds cleanly between uses. For large events, consider multiple molds or a multi-grid model to maximize output while keeping the skull shapes uniform and presentable.
